Ingredients for Easy Keto Donuts

  • 1 cup almond flour (for a low carb donut recipe)
  • ¼ cup coconut flour
  • ½ cup erythritol (or preferred keto sweetener)
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• ¼ tsp salt
  • 3 large eggs
  • ¼ cup melted butter (or coconut oil)
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ract
  • ¼ cup unsweetened almond milk

How to Make Keto Donuts (Step-by-Step)

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a donut pan.
  2. Mix dry ingredients – almond flour, coconut flour, sweetener, baking powder, and salt.
  3. Whisk wet ingredients – eggs, melted butter, vanilla, and almond milk.
  4. Combine wet & dry until smooth.
  5. Pipe batter into donut molds (or spoon carefully).
  6. Bake for 12-15 minutes until golden.
  7. Cool before glazing (optional).

Optional Sugar-Free Glaze

For a classic donut finish, mix:

  • ½ cup powdered erythritol
  • 1-2 tbsp almond milk
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ract

Drizzle over cooled donuts for a sugar-free donut recipe delight!

Variations & Tips

Make keto donut holes: Use a mini muffin tin for bite-sized treats!

Add protein powder: Turn these into protein donuts healthy by adding a scoop of vanilla or chocolate protein powder.

Try different flavors: Cinnamon, cocoa powder, or lemon zest can add variety.

Storage: Keep in an airtight container for up to 3 days or freeze for longer shelf life.

Nutrition Facts (Per Donut)

  • Calories: 120
  • Fat: 10g
  • Net Carbs: 3g
  • Protein: 4g
